Chris Henry Tapped as VRE COO

The Virginia Railway Express (VRE) has announced the selection of Chris Henry as the agency’s Chief Operations Officer (COO), effective March 14, 2026.

Port of Los Angeles: February Cargo Volume ‘Second Best on Record’

The Port of Los Angeles processed 824,232 Twenty-Foot Equivalent Units (TEUs) in February, marking the second-busiest February in the Port’s history and an increase of 3% compared to last year.
